ISO7721DR Digital Isolator IC SOIC-8 is a high-reliability, dual-channel digital isolator designed to achieve robust galvanic isolation between sensitive low-voltage control circuits and noisy high-voltage systems. This device utilizes Silicon Dioxide ($\text{SiO}_2$) as a barrier, providing superior immunity against magnetic interference and excellent common-mode transient immunity (CMTI). Consequently, the ISO7721DR ensures safe and accurate data transfer across isolation barriers up to 3000 VRMS. Furthermore, its low power consumption and high data rate capability make it an indispensable component for protecting microcontrollers and other digital circuits in harsh industrial and medical environments. Therefore, system designers choose the ISO7721DR to meet critical safety standards and enhance signal integrity.

Key Features:
  • High Isolation Rating: Provides 3000 VRMS (1 minute) galvanic isolation, protecting low-voltage sides from high-voltage spikes and ground loops.
  • Dual-Channel Configuration: Features two independent isolation channels; the ISO7721DR specifically offers one forward and one reverse channel (1/1 directionality).
  • High Data Rate: Supports data rates up to 100 Mbps, ensuring fast and real-time communication across the isolation barrier.
  • High CMTI: Offers a high Common-Mode Transient Immunity (CMTI) of ±100 kV/μs (typical), maintaining data integrity even with severe noise transients.
  • Low Power Consumption: Consumes low power, hence minimizing heat generation and reducing overall system power requirements.
  • Wide Supply Voltage Range: Supports both VCC1 and VCC2 supply voltages from 2.25 V to 5.5 V, simplifying interface design with various logic levels.
Technical Specifications:
  • Isolation Voltage (VISO): 3000 VRMS
  • Max Data Rate: 100 Mbps
  • Propagation Delay: Typically 10.7 ns
  • Minimum CMTI: 100 kV/μs (Transient Immunity)
  • Supply Voltage Range (VCC1, VCC2): 2.25 V to 5.5 V
  • Output Default State: High (Fail-safe state in the absence of input power)
  • Operating Temperature Range: −40°C to +125°C
Mechanical Specifications:
  • Package Type: SOIC-8 (Small Outline Integrated Circuit, 8-Pin)
  • Mounting: Surface-Mount Technology (SMT)
  • Barrier Material: Silicon Dioxide ($\text{SiO}_2$)
  • Creepage/Clearance: 4 mm (Meeting standard safety requirements)
Dimensions:
  • Body Length: ≈ 4.9 mm
  • Body Width: ≈ 3.9 mm
  • Pin Pitch: 1.27 mm (Standard SOIC pitch)
  • Height: ≈ 1.6 mm

Pinout and Wiring:
  • VCC1 (Pin 1): Power supply for the input (Channel 1) side.
  • GND1 (Pin 2): Ground reference for the input side.
  • IN1 (Pin 3): Digital input channel.
  • OUT2 (Pin 4): Digital output channel (Data flows from side 2 to side 1).
  • OUT1 (Pin 5): Digital output channel (Data flows from side 1 to side 2).
  • IN2 (Pin 6): Digital input channel.
  • GND2 (Pin 7): Ground reference for the output (Channel 2) side.
  • VCC2 (Pin 8): Power supply for the output side.
  • Note: Therefore, ensure VCC1 and VCC2 derive from separate, isolated power supplies to maintain the integrity of the galvanic isolation barrier.

Commonly Used in:
  • Industrial Control: Isolating PLC interfaces, motor drives, and sensor I/O.
  • Medical Devices: Furthermore, doctors utilize these isolators in patient monitoring equipment to achieve essential safety isolation.
  • Power Supplies: Providing feedback signal isolation in switch-mode power supplies and battery management systems (BMS).
Applications:
  • Ground Loop Elimination: Breaking ground loops between different voltage domains in complex systems.
  • Isolated Serial Communication: Isolating UART, SPI, and I2C buses between host processors and peripherals.
  • High-Side/Low-Side Gate Driver Interface: Safely driving MOSFETs and IGBTs in power conversion applications.
Equivalent Models:
  • ADuM1201 (Analog Devices): A widely used dual-channel digital isolator with similar performance and pinout (often interchangeable).
  • Si8421 (Silicon Labs): A competitor dual-channel isolator, however, verify the directionality (1/1) before replacing.
  • TLP2301 (Toshiba): A high-speed optocoupler that functions as a digital isolator, though it may have different speed and power characteristics.
